Forever World Cup Simulator changes
Players
A potential attribute is used to set a soft ceiling on player development. If a performance attribute (such as attack or defense) exceeds the potential value, it is likely to be pulled back over time. Potential may also change slightly each season.
The attribute can be edited using the player editor.
At the start of each save, players may have lower initial ratings, allowing them to develop over time based on their growth type (e.g. late, standard).
Players are now much less likely to remain active into 40+ seasons.
64-Team World Cup with Old European Qualifiers Format
This special World Cup event is available in the "Add-on" section. It replaces the league-stage format with the traditional round-robin group stage.
